Team, please sign in and subscribe. Also post your thoughts on Pangaea vs Continents. While Pangaea will give us earlier contact and thus earlier opportunities to flex our diplomatic muscle, it may also lead to earlier warfare if we're all stuffed together.
 
If we're going for a diplomatic victory, I'd say continents. If we're on a Pangea, meeting everyone early leads to too many "stop trading with our worst enemy" and "you decalred war on our friend" diplomatic headaches.

On continents, we can really work on relations on our own contient first, and then mid-game we meet the other AIs and will have an idea how they relate with each other, and can pick our friends more carefully.

I believe Pangaea would probably be in our best interest. We'd start out knowing everyone real early and would have a better chance of figuring out who are friends and enemies are. Even in a diplomatic game war is still inevitable.

With continents you start off knowing very few AI's, sometimes none, and won't meet anyone else until well into the game. Yes, we can really work hard on any AI's on our continent, but IMO to truly work on our diplomatic skills we should have as many contacts as possible as early as possible.
